Safety planning basics
Creating a safety plan is a proactive step you can take to protect yourself. Consider the following basics:
- Identify safe places to go in an emergency.
- Have a packed bag ready with essential items.
- Share your plan with someone you trust.
- Keep important documents in a secure but accessible location.
- Establish a code word with friends or family for discreet communication.
